About this song

Rock and Roll Music by The Beatles is in A major (estimated), around 167 BPM, 4/4 time. This 5-track arrangement runs 2:22 (Bright acoustic piano, Electric guitar (clean), Electric bass (finger), Lead 6 (voice), and Drums). 6 versions available to play and practice.
